Systematic Single Cell Pathway Analysis (SCPA) reveals novel pathways engaged during early T cell activation

2022-02-10

Abstract excerpt

<h4>Summary</h4> Next generation sequencing technologies have revolutionized the study of T cell biology, capturing previously unrecognized diversity in cellular states and functions. Pathway analysis is a key analytical stage in the interpretation of such transcriptomic data, providing a powerful method for detecting alterations in important biological processes.
